Road cycling routes around Vilaür traverse a diverse landscape within Catalonia's Empordà region. The area features expansive agricultural fields and picturesque vineyards, characteristic of the Empordà plain, which transitions into the initial slopes of the "terraprims." Pine forests are also present, offering varied scenery, and the proximity to the Ter River adds natural appeal. This terrain provides a mix of flat, rolling, and challenging routes for road cyclists.

En un paratge natural d’indescriptible bellesa, és un dels llacs més grans de la península Ibèrica. Fou la seu de les competicions de rem durant els Jocs Olímpics de Barcelona 1992. Per a més informació: https://costabrava.org/on-anar/comarques/pla-de-lestany/banyoles/

L’antiga Emporion va esdevenir porta d’entrada de les civilitzacions grega i romana a la Península a través de la Mediterrània. Per a més informació: https://costabrava.org/experiencia/empuries-visita-romana/

Road cycling routes around Vilaür offer numerous scenic highlights. You can experience breathtaking views from the Rocacorba Summit, enjoy the tranquil beauty of Lake Banyoles, or traverse routes that offer both mountainous terrain and coastal scenery. The region is also characterized by picturesque vineyards and agricultural fields, and you might cross the Ter River via the Colomers Dam Footbridge or Sobranigues Footbridge.
Yes, the region boasts several long-distance routes. For example, the Banyuls Pass – Monastery of Sant Pere de Rodes loop from Camallera covers over 90 miles (147 km), and the Cadaqués – Sant Pere Pescador loop from Camallera is over 95 miles (154 km), both offering extensive rides through varied landscapes.

Absolutely. The region is known for challenging climbs, notably the Rocacorba Summit, which is part of routes like the Lake Banyoles – Rocacorba Summit Viewpoint loop from Camallera. These climbs offer rewarding panoramic views and are often used by professional cyclists.
Yes, Vilaür's strategic location allows access to several historical sites. You can explore the magnificent medieval old town of Vilaür itself, or cycle to nearby attractions such as the Historic Center of Ventalló. The region also offers access to the medieval core of Sant Martí d'Empúries and the Greek ruins of Empúries.
